WebJul 21, 2024 · Proper Takeaway. Keeping the arms and body in sync through the takeaway is the result of correct form and practice. Your arms should move backward in a straight pattern, parallel to your body, and parallel to the flight path of the ball. Once you reach parallel to the ground, your shoulders turn to the top to finish the backswing.

WebSimply put, the takeaway is the beginning of the golf swing. References to the takeaway generally mean the first couple of feet of the swing as the clubhead moves back from the ball.. A proper takeaway engages your arms, shoulders, hips and torso, which must work together throughout the swing.
